Niobe, a figure from Greek mythology, is said to have had fourteen children, seven sons and seven daughters. She was famously proud of her offspring, boasting about them and challenging the goddess Leto, who had only two children, Apollo and Artemis. As a result of her hubris, Niobe faced dire consequences, leading to the death of all her children. This tragic fate serves as a cautionary tale about pride and the consequences of offending the gods.
